Zacarias Lucas Lázaro Nguenha is a 31-year-old Mozambican poet and educator, born on February 20, 1994, in Munhinga, Sussundenga, Manica Province. He recently won the 7th edition of the Fernando Leite Couto Literary Prize for his poetry collection 'Costurar a Linguagem.' Nguenha, who holds a degree in Portuguese Language from the Catholic University of Mozambique and is currently pursuing a law degree at the University of Púnguè, is also known for his debut book 'Confissões da Madrugada' released in 2024. His work reflects a deep engagement with the themes of identity and the human experience, showcasing his technical prowess and maturity as a writer.
